Quantisation ladder
| Quant | Weights | Total @ 8K | Max context | Tok/s | Quality | Fit |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Q8_0 | 107.9 GB | 110.0 GB | 734K | 12 | −0.1% ppl | Long context |
| Q6_K | 83.2 GB | 85.3 GB | 1024K | 16 | −0.4% ppl | Long context |
| Q5_K_M | 71.9 GB | 74.0 GB | 1024K | 19 | −0.8% ppl | Long context |
| Q4_K_M | 61.3 GB | 63.4 GB | 1024K | 22 | −1.9% ppl | Recommended |
| Q3_K_M | 49.6 GB | 51.7 GB | 1024K | 27 | −5.4% ppl | Long context |
| Q2_K | 42.5 GB | 44.6 GB | 1024K | 31 | −15% ppl | Long context |
Quality is the published perplexity delta against f16 weights. Max context assumes an f16 KV cache; q8_0 roughly doubles it. This model interleaves sliding-window layers (8192 tokens, 12 of 48 layers global), which is why its cache barely grows with context.
